117.info
人生若只如初见

怎么使用maven创建web项目

使用Maven创建Web项目的步骤如下:

  1. 确保已经安装了Maven,并且在系统的环境变量中配置了Maven的路径。

  2. 打开命令行或终端,进入希望创建项目的目录。

  3. 使用以下命令创建Maven项目骨架:

mvn archetype:generate -DgroupId=com.example -DartifactId=my-webapp -DarchetypeArtifactId=maven-archetype-webapp -DinteractiveMode=false

这将创建一个基本的Maven Web项目结构。

  1. 进入新创建的项目目录:
cd my-webapp
  1. 打开项目的pom.xml文件,并在其中添加需要的依赖。例如,如果要使用Servlet和JSP,可以添加以下依赖:


javax.servlet
javax.servlet-api
4.0.1


javax.servlet
jstl
1.2


这将在项目构建时下载所需的依赖。

  1. 编写自己的Java类和JSP文件,根据需要创建其他文件和目录。

  2. 使用以下命令构建和打包项目:

mvn package
  1. 构建成功后,将在target目录中生成一个WAR文件。

  2. 将WAR文件部署到Web服务器中即可。

以上就是使用Maven创建Web项目的基本步骤。请注意,根据你的具体需求和项目结构,你可能需要进行一些额外的配置和调整。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e9daAzsLBAdRAlA.html

推荐文章

  • 使用maven进行开发的好处有哪些

    使用Maven进行开发有以下好处: 依赖管理:Maven可以自动解决项目所需的所有依赖,并且能够管理这些依赖的版本。开发人员可以通过简单地在POM文件中添加依赖来引...

  • maven怎么配置私有仓库

    要将私有仓库配置到Maven中,您需要进行以下步骤: 在您的私有仓库服务器上设置好仓库。这可以是一个本地文件系统的目录,也可以是一个远程服务器。 在您的Maven...

  • maven私有仓库有哪些特点

    Maven私有仓库具有以下特点: 安全性:私有仓库只能被授权的用户访问,可以对仓库进行权限控制,保护敏感信息和代码。 可定制性:私有仓库可以根据组织的需求进行...

  • maven怎么修改依赖包版本

    要修改 Maven 项目的依赖包版本,可以按照以下步骤进行操作: 打开项目的 pom.xml 文件。
    在 标签中找到需要修改版本的依赖包。
    在该依赖包的 标签内,...

  • delphi动态数组如何赋值

    在Delphi中,可以使用动态数组的SetLength函数来分配数组的内存空间,并使用索引来赋值。以下是一个示例:
    var
    myArray: array of Integer;
    i: I...

  • Win11右键图标没反应怎么办

    如果您在Windows 11中右键单击图标时没有任何反应,您可以尝试以下方法来解决该问题: 重新启动计算机:有时候,重新启动计算机可以解决许多问题,包括右键图标无...

  • win11大小核调度怎么调整

    要调整Windows 11的大小核调度,可以按照以下步骤进行操作: 打开"任务管理器"。可以通过按下"Ctrl + Shift + Esc"键组合来快速打开任务管理器,或者右键点击任务...

  • Win11如何调高进程的优先级

    要调高进程的优先级,您可以按照以下步骤操作: 打开任务管理器:右键单击任务栏,然后选择“任务管理器”。 切换到“进程”选项卡:在任务管理器中,点击“详细...